Mundial 5100 Series 7-Inch Santoku Knife, BlackI'm not a professional but this knife seems like a well constructed, heavy duty knife. It is extremely sharp out of the boxonly time will tell if it lives up to expectations. Thus far, it compares favorably to my Henckels 8" chef's knife. The Mundial 5100 7" Santoku is actually heavier though the handle is slightly smaller.

After picking up the 10 inch Mundial 5100 French-style chef's knife I was impressed enough with its quality to go with them again for a good utility knife for "in betweener" jobs.

Being 6"1' anything under 10" is too small as an all around chef's knife and I've found this santoku is a perfect halfway between a paring and chef's knife--the ever needed utility knife. If you prefer the smaller blades (8" chef's knife) this might not replace a sturdier French-style chef's knife but it's well worth the investment for the finer things.

I'm generally a minimalist as far as the knives I use but this was definitely worth the extra slot on my magnet.

As far as overall Mundial 5100 series quality, as I said in my French knife review, it stands pretty well with the knives that cost 3x as much. The little bit of sharpness you sacrifice is more than made up for by increase in sturdiness.
